Hi, I have download the trial version of the program, I found that it is the greatest program
for call blocking I tried.

However, I would like to ask the meaning of "hang up".

I tried to setup a rule as below

Rule type: Incoming Call
Filter type: Specific Number
Phone #: <my office number>
Action1: Hang up
Action2: Do nothing

I tried to call my phone with my office phone, the MagiCall shown
"Incoming call from xxx has been hang up",
from the view of my phone, it will not ring, that what I want.
from the view of office phone, it is not hang up immediately, just ring

I also setup "Filter Unknown Numbers" and "Filter Anonymous" to Hang up,
the caller heard the busy status immediately, is there any issue?

Thanks in advance.
